      • getLabelResource

         String getLabelResource()

        Get the component's resource name, which getStaticLabel uses to derive the component's label in the local language. The resource name is fixed, and does not vary with the selected language.

        Normally this method should be overridden in preference to overriding getStaticLabel(). However where the resource name is not available or required, getStaticLabel() may be overridden instead.

        Returns:

        the resource name

      • modifyTestElement

         Unit modifyTestElement(TestElement element)

        GUI components are responsible for populating TestElements they create with the data currently held in the GUI components. This method should overwrite whatever data is currently in the TestElement as it is called after a user has filled out the form elements in the gui with new information.

        If you override AbstractJMeterGuiComponent, you might want using bindingGroup instead of overriding modifyTestElement.

        The canonical implementation looks like this:

        @Override
        public void modifyTestElement(TestElement element) {
            super.modifyTestElement(element); // clear the element and assign basic fields like name, gui class, test class
            // Using the element setters (preferred):
            // If the field is empty, you probably want to remove the property instead of storing an empty string
            // See Streamline binding of UI elements to TestElement properties
            // for more details
            TestElementXYZ xyz = (TestElementXYZ) element;
            xyz.setState(StringUtils.defaultIfEmpty(guiState.getText(), null));
            xyz.setCode(StringUtils.defaultIfEmpty(guiCode.getText(), null));
            ... other GUI fields ...
            // or directly (do not use unless there is no setter for the field):
            element.setProperty(TestElementXYZ.STATE, StringUtils.defaultIfEmpty(guiState.getText(), null))
            element.setProperty(TestElementXYZ.CODE, StringUtils.defaultIfEmpty(guiCode.getText(), null))
            ... other GUI fields ...
        }
